What is covered in this Certification Program?

  1. This Certified Industrial Facility Corrosion Technology Professional Workshop provides the Industrial Corrosion Practitioner the Practical Understanding, Process Information, Knowledge, Skills and Competencies for Protecting his responsible Facilities from Corrosion Damage and Maintain them in Good Safe Operational Conditions.
  2. Program discusses practices to meet NACE, Your Organizational Standards and Specifications, and other International Standards and Recommendations. Effective Corrosion Monitoring and Management is essential for Reliability, Safety, Cost Reduction, Improving Remaining Life and Improving Quality and Efficiency of Facilities.
  3. This program provides the participant the knowledge and practical skills to Identify, Monitor, Inspect and Measure Corrosion in his facilities. The use cases discussed in this program include Oil & Gas, Bridges, Offshore and Marine, Storage Tanks & Ship Holds, Transmission Lines, Pipelines, Large Industrial and Civil Structures.
  4. Participant may elect to work on Special detailed Case Study workshop for any one of (1) Corrosion in Refinery Industry (2) Corrosion in Pipelines (3) Corrosion in Oil & Gas Downhole (4) Bridge Corrosion (5) Power Plant Corrosion (6) Corrosion in Steel Structures (7) Corrosion in Coastal Structures.
  5. The participant will become familiar with, and be able to work with, the established and latest Corrosion Identification, Inspecting, Measuring Tools and Techniques in his work area. The program case studies will be customized to meet the needs and expectations of each group of participants.
  6. The participant will be able to prepare plans for Corrosion Monitoring, Report Corrosion Trends, Health of Facilities, Recommend Protection Methods and Inspect Corrosion Protection Works and Installations. Program will discuss Systems for Building Corrosion Knowledge Base Relevant to your Organization, Implement Training and Development Activities for your Staff in Corrosion Awareness and Management, and Use Data Analytics for timely insight into Corrosion Related Issues and Management Interventions. This program provides Practical 360 degree Multi-discipline Understanding of the Corrosion Related Issues.
